Subtract 28/45 from 49/6
1st number: 8 1/6, 2nd number: 28/45
49/6 - 28/45 is 679/90.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 6 and 45 is 90
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 90 - For the 1st fraction, since 6 × 15 = 90,
49/6 = 49 × 15/6 × 15 = 735/90 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 45 × 2 = 90,
28/45 = 28 × 2/45 × 2 = 56/90 - Subtract the two like fractions:
